India Suspends Visa Services for Pakistanis Post Pahalgam Tragedy

The Indian Government has announced the immediate suspension of visa services for Pakistani nationals after the terror attack devastated Pahalgam, South Kashmir, claiming the lives of 26 innocent people.


The serene tourist haven turned into a scene of horror, with several others left injured. This grim event is now etched as one of the most severe attacks since the revocation of Article 370 in 2019.

The Indian government took a firm stance, announcing the immediate suspension of visa services for Pakistani nationals. Effective April 27, all valid visas stand revoked except for medical visas, which retain validity until April 29. Pakistani nationals currently in India have been advised to leave before their visas expire. Similarly, Indian citizens are strongly discouraged from travelling to Pakistan.

As the region reels from the aftermath, security has been intensified in Pahalgam. Search operations are underway to track the culprits behind this heinous crime. Visuals from the once-bustling streets depict a ghostly silence, reflecting the sombre mood. Public outrage has surged, with organisations calling for a Jammu bandh and political parties demanding accountability for security lapses.

This tragedy marks a turning point, prompting serious discussions on measures to bolster national security and protect innocent lives.
